Diatonic Thirds Chain

In the key of E major, play chord tones in thirds: E-G#, F#-A, G#-B, A-C#, B-D#, C#-E, D#-F#. Connect each interval smoothly using the shortest possible movements between chord changes. Play as continuous eighth notes with swing feel.

Tip: Thirds are the most important intervals in harmony. Master these movements and you'll hear chord progressions like a jazz musician.
